#e55d5a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e55d5a is composed of 89.8% red, 36.5%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.4%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 62.5%. #e55d5a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bab4 with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e55d5a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e55d5a has RGB values of R:229, G:93, B:90 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.61,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15031642.

Hex triplet e55d5a #e55d5a
RGB Decimal 229, 93, 90 rgb(229,93,90)
RGB Percent 89.8, 36.5, 35.3 rgb(89.8%,36.5%,35.3%)
CMYK 0, 59, 61, 10
HSL 1.3°, 72.8, 62.5 hsl(1.3,72.8%,62.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 1.3°, 60.7, 89.8
Web Safe cc6666 #cc6666
CIE-LAB 57.298, 52.644, 29.076
XYZ 38.074, 25.229, 12.537
xyY 0.502, 0.333, 25.229
CIE-LCH 57.298, 60.14, 28.913
CIE-LUV 57.298, 102.442, 23.586
Hunter-Lab 50.228, 47.408, 20.361
Binary 11100101, 01011101, 01011010
